Gregory Howe Obituary

Gregory J. "Bud" Howe, Sr., 67, a 33-year resident of Brookfield passed away July 8, 2008 at Hinsdale Hospital. Gregory was born March 18, 1941 in Chicago, IL. He served in the U.S. Army. He was a truck driver and he enjoyed camping. Visitation will be held from 3-9 p.m. on Thursday, July 10 at Hallowell & James Funeral Home, 1025 W. 55th St., Countryside. Services 11 a.m. Friday, July 11, 2008 at the funeral home. Interment will be private. Gregory is survived by his children, Gregory, Jr. (Lana) of Romeoville, IL, Brian (Adriana) of Brookfield, IL and Amy (Curt) Coffey of Concord, NC; grandchildren, Alyssa Coffey, Grace, Lillyana, Aidan and Anabella Howe; siblings, the late Murph (Carole) of Morton Grove, Il and the late Jerry (Marilyn) of Lockport, IL; parents, the late George and the late Margaret, nee Egan; parents-in-law, the late William (Anne) Donovan and also many nieces and nephews. In lieu of flowers, memorials to St. Jude Children's Research Hospital appreciated. Funeral arrangements handled by Hallowell & James Funeral Home, (708) 352-6500.
Published by Central Cook Suburban Life on Jul. 9, 2008.
